Vietnam’s financial sector has expanded significantly during the past decade. According to the State Bank of Vietnam, total banking assets have continued to grow at an annual rate of more than 10 percent in recent years. This growth reflects the country’s rising economic activity, increasing investment flows, and strong demand for financial services.
Digital transformation is also changing how financial institutions operate. The Vietnam Banking Association reports that digital banking transactions now account for a large share of daily banking activity. Mobile payments, QR-based transactions, and online banking platforms are widely used across major cities and increasingly in rural areas.
Government policies have supported this shift. Initiatives encouraging fintech innovation and open collaboration between banks and technology firms have also created a more competitive ecosystem.
